If the stationary phase is a lot more polar compared to cell stage, the separation is considered normal phase. If your stationary stage is fewer polar in comparison to the cell stage, the separation is reverse phase. In reverse stage HPLC the retention time of a compound boosts with lowering polarity of The actual species. The key to a powerful and efficient separation is to determine the appropriate ratio among polar and non-polar components in the cellular section.
